Succession: With Open Eyes (2023)
Like a Greek tragedy
Succession's previous three season have all been about how the Roy children were orbiting Logan. The brilliant thing about season 4 is they completely imploded that dynamic, which in turn have sent all three of the siblings descending into their worst selves. They literally don't know how to do it with their whole, harsh universe (Logan) gone.
This episode, then, sees that ever-downward spiral finally hit its climax. None of the Roy children are fit to do anything really, and they are deeply awful people, and some of them finally come to that realization. The way Roman so eloquently puts it, they are literally nothing.
This was an absolutely savage, sometimes emotionally scarring and one of the saddest finales I've ever seen.
The White Lotus (2021)
This is satire at its most sardonic and hopeless
This show is really something else. At the surface, some people might dismiss it as "silly" or "too weird" but it is really one of the best satires out there.
Almost every interaction is littered with biting takes on class struggles and how they play with sexual politics. Sometimes the dialogue is really simple and dry, but the actors faces' say just as much as their words. In this show, body language is so important! It is almost like what they don't say to each other is just as important as what they do say.
Aside from that it is peppered with the most zonky characters ever, but all of them ring true. Like, these are people who could well be actual living people. Well, awful actual living people more like it. But you get the point.
I hope this show goes on for at least 5 seasons. It's brilliant satire.

Hereditary (2018)
One of the best horror movies I've ever seen
Wow. I am out of words.
I honestly didn't care for The Witch, and I don't get why people find this so similar to it. Maybe it's the pace. But there is something here so visceral and intense that I feel like comparing it to the likes of The Shining and The Exorcist.
This movie, from the very beginning, feels extremely sad and hopeless. It never lets up for even a second. Even when things are fairly normal near the beginning, it feels weird, like something is lurking at every turn.
When things start happening, man they REALLY start happening. There are some chilling moments here. Mind you, the creepiness here doesn't come from visually horrible things, or jump scares. The scares in this movie linger, creeping up on you when you least expect it. I saw this movie two weeks ago and when I go to sleep I always remember the fate of this family and get chills. It is really that effective. And I've never felt this way with any movie, like EVER.
And then there's the acting. Oh my god, the acting is like a punch in the gut and three in the face. I was particularly impressed with Alex Wolff, especially in the infamous car scene. And Toni, please, have all the awards already!
All in all, it's a remarkable film, that puts the horror in the grief and heart wrenching loss this family is going through. From the beginning you get the feeling this family is doomed. And by the end, you are already crying in despair, with an ending so out of the leftfield you can't help but sit there baffled at what's just unfolded onscreen.
